自動(dòng)中藥煎藥機(jī)的設(shè)計(jì)與開發(fā)
介紹了自動(dòng)中藥煎藥機(jī)的工作原理、軟硬件組成及系統(tǒng)功能。與其他同類產(chǎn)品的溫度控制原理不同,系統(tǒng)采用分時(shí)功率控制.煎的工藝更符合中藥藥,其效果與傳統(tǒng)的中藥煎基本相同。該系統(tǒng)采用中中斷服務(wù)子程序完成LED動(dòng)態(tài)顯示,解決了動(dòng)態(tài)顯示軟件設(shè)計(jì)中的復(fù)雜問題,通過調(diào)整輸出方波占空比來控制雙向晶閘管的導(dǎo)通和截止時(shí)間,從而控制輸出功率,避免了PWM控制,在軟硬件設(shè)計(jì)上更加復(fù)雜。系統(tǒng)設(shè)計(jì)思路簡(jiǎn)單明了。
1導(dǎo)言
中民族烹飪和中藥被稱為中中華民族對(duì)世界的兩大貢獻(xiàn)。然而,傳統(tǒng)的中藥煎方法給城市生活帶來了很大的不便。為了方便城市居民的生活,韓國(guó)開發(fā)了第一款自動(dòng)煎藥機(jī)。從那時(shí)起,自動(dòng)煎藥機(jī)在各大醫(yī)院和藥工廠得到了廣泛的應(yīng)用,并很快被引進(jìn)中國(guó)。實(shí)踐證明,與傳統(tǒng)的煎方法相比,煎XCB6XCB5X煎具有以下優(yōu)點(diǎn):(1)提高工作效率,方便患者家屬;(2)減輕工作量;(3)確保中藥的療效;(4)減少差錯(cuò)的發(fā)生;(5)節(jié)約能耗;(6)更符合衛(wèi)生要求。隨著生產(chǎn)廠家的增加和競(jìng)爭(zhēng)的加劇,煎藥機(jī)的性能有了很大的提高。該系統(tǒng)以工作性能穩(wěn)定、價(jià)格低廉的機(jī)單片機(jī)為硬件基礎(chǔ),結(jié)合中藥煎的要求,設(shè)計(jì)了符合中藥藥的軟件,具有操作簡(jiǎn)單、工作性能可靠等優(yōu)點(diǎn),在實(shí)際中中得到了用戶的高度評(píng)價(jià)。
2.系統(tǒng)原理和功能
2.1.基本原則
目前,大多數(shù)常用的自動(dòng)煎藥機(jī)采用溫度控制方法,即在煎工藝的不同階段對(duì)湯藥的溫度進(jìn)行不同的控制。煎的原理與傳統(tǒng)的煎有很大的不同。傳統(tǒng)的中藥煎主要依靠火災(zāi)來控制煎的作用。該系統(tǒng)控制中藥煎系統(tǒng)的分時(shí)能力。通過控制各時(shí)程的加熱功率,模擬了傳統(tǒng)煎方法的火災(zāi)、中火災(zāi)和小火災(zāi),使自動(dòng)煎系統(tǒng)與傳統(tǒng)的煎方法具有相同或相似的效果。在采用煎系統(tǒng)之前,可以調(diào)整系統(tǒng)的正、倒計(jì)時(shí)設(shè)定時(shí)間、各模式的輸出功率(系統(tǒng)的功率整定值為全功率的百分比)、溫度保護(hù)范圍等。定時(shí)控制是通過打破單個(gè)機(jī)的內(nèi)部時(shí)序中來完成的。功率輸出采用內(nèi)部中控制輸出方波占空比,輸出脈沖控制雙向晶閘管開斷時(shí)間,從而控制平均輸出功率。該控制方法比PWM控制簡(jiǎn)單,操作簡(jiǎn)單,適用于控制要求不高的場(chǎng)合。不同的輸出功率對(duì)應(yīng)于不同的工作模式(分為全功率模式、a和B倒計(jì)時(shí)模式)。這些模式分別對(duì)應(yīng)于中藥傳統(tǒng)煎方法的火災(zāi)、中火災(zāi)和小火災(zāi)。為了防止系統(tǒng)溫度過高而燒毀加熱裝置,系統(tǒng)對(duì)加熱溫度進(jìn)行監(jiān)測(cè),以避免發(fā)生故障。#p#分頁標(biāo)題#e#
2.2.系統(tǒng)功能
主要結(jié)果如下:(1)參數(shù)的可調(diào)函數(shù)。在啟動(dòng)煎系統(tǒng)之前,可以對(duì)系統(tǒng)的所有參數(shù)進(jìn)行調(diào)整,并將調(diào)整后的參數(shù)保存在EEPROM芯片中中,該芯片可以被切斷和維護(hù),供以后參考。在煎的過程中,中還可以調(diào)整當(dāng)前的定時(shí)值,以延長(zhǎng)或縮短當(dāng)前煎系統(tǒng)的持續(xù)時(shí)間;(2)數(shù)字顯示功能。用3位LED動(dòng)態(tài)顯示定時(shí)值和系統(tǒng)設(shè)置參數(shù).為了便于維護(hù),還用于在溫度采集系統(tǒng)中顯示超過熱敏電阻標(biāo)準(zhǔn)的短路、開路和溫度。(3)自動(dòng)報(bào)警功能。當(dāng)系統(tǒng)發(fā)生故障時(shí),即熱敏電阻短路、斷路和當(dāng)前加熱溫度超過系統(tǒng)設(shè)定的溫度范圍時(shí),蜂鳴器立即報(bào)警,LED顯示相應(yīng)的報(bào)警信息。用戶確認(rèn)告警信息后,告警狀態(tài)解除;(4)斷電數(shù)據(jù)保護(hù)功能。將系統(tǒng)參數(shù)保存到EEPROM中后,數(shù)據(jù)不會(huì)丟失。
3.硬件電路組成
系統(tǒng)硬件電路的設(shè)計(jì)思想是在保證系統(tǒng)功能和運(yùn)行可靠性的前提下,盡可能降低成本。因此,系統(tǒng)選用機(jī)單片機(jī)作為控制和信息處理的核心。機(jī)單片機(jī)具有體積小、安裝方便、可靠性好、貨源充足等優(yōu)點(diǎn),適合大規(guī)模生產(chǎn)和應(yīng)用。AT89C52具有3臺(tái)16位定時(shí)中斷路器、8k閃存EPROM、256字節(jié)RAM、32根I/O線,指令系統(tǒng)與MCS 51單片機(jī)機(jī)兼容,二次電可擦除,程序可加密三級(jí),安全性高,性價(jià)比高。該系統(tǒng)需要大量的時(shí)序中故障和大容量的程序存儲(chǔ),因此選用AT89C52作為硬件核心,而不是AT89C51,價(jià)格稍低。TLC 549是德州儀器公司生產(chǎn)的10位模擬數(shù)字轉(zhuǎn)換器.它采用CMOS工藝,具有內(nèi)部采樣和保持、差分基準(zhǔn)電壓的高電阻輸入、抗干擾、按比例范圍校準(zhǔn)轉(zhuǎn)換范圍、最大ISB(4.8rev)、少串行通信引腳(一個(gè)機(jī)3引腳)、小芯片尺寸等特點(diǎn)。因此,它被選為模擬數(shù)字轉(zhuǎn)換器.系統(tǒng)采用24C01C存儲(chǔ)系統(tǒng)參數(shù)。24C01C的存儲(chǔ)空間較小,具有較小的串行通信能力。只有2個(gè)引腳連接到一個(gè)機(jī)上,讀寫方便,可讀寫頁面,數(shù)據(jù)存儲(chǔ)可靠性強(qiáng)。硬件電路原理。